Bolstering Child Safety and Providing Parental ReassuranceIn today's ever-changing world, the safety of one's offspring remains the foremost concern for any parent. Innovations in technology have introduced effective tools aimed at lessen some of this worry, and wearable devices for young ones stand at the forefront of this movement. A significant advantage of such devices is the inclusion of real-time location monitoring. This functionality enables parents to ascertain their child's precise location via a companion application, providing a deep sense of security throughout the day. If a youngster is at school, at a playdate house, or returning from an activity, parents can easily confirm their child's safety. In addition, many of these watches feature a geofencing capability, which allows parents to define virtual perimeters for specific areas like the neighborhood or school. Should the child leaves or enters these zones, an automatic notification is dispatched to the guardian's smartphone, allowing for immediate awareness.
In addition to passive tracking, these advanced wearables come with active emergency features that give the child a degree of control in an emergency. Perhaps the most vital of these is the SOS button. With a quick press of a dedicated key, the user in distress can instantly trigger an alert that is sent to a parent-designated list of emergency numbers. This signal typically contains the child's precise GPS coordinates and may even open a an automatic voice call, allowing guardians to hear the surroundings and assess what is happening. This immediate line of communication is priceless in emergency scenarios, providing a faster reaction compared to conventional methods. The psychological benefit for parents who know their child possesses this safety tool readily available should not be overstated. It changes a kids' smart watch from a mere accessory into a powerful reassurance instrument.
Building Confidence via Managed Connections
One of the challenging aspects of contemporary child-rearing is knowing when and how to to give children more autonomy. A connected watch can be an excellent intermediate step in this very journey. These devices are designed to provide connectivity features while avoiding the unrestricted dangers of a standard smartphone. They typically enable two-way voice calls and text or voice messaging, but with a crucial limitation: the user can only communicate with a parent-approved whitelisted list of contacts. This functionality completely prevents any unsolicited communication from strangers or possible bullies, creating a secure and private social circle for the child. Parents have complete control over who who is able to reach their young one, and who their child can contact.
This managed environment is instrumental in building a youngster's feeling of independence. A young person who is given the freedom to travel to a nearby park or remain for a bit longer at an after-school extracurricular activity experiences a sense of empowerment and responsibility. Having the ability to easily contact a guardian if their plans are altered, if they need need help, or simply to check in reinforces their self-assurance. It instructs children the basics of responsible communication and planning. Unlike a smartphone, which can be a gateway to unsupervised games, social networks, and the open internet, a specialized wearable maintains the focus on essential connectivity and security. It serves as a suitable middle ground, granting children the independence they crave while providing guardians the control they require.
Promoting an Active and Healthy Lifestyle
In an era progressively defined by screens, encouraging children to be physically active is now a significant parental challenge. A lot of contemporary connected watches for young users tackle this very concern by including engaging and interactive health and activity trackers. These gadgets often come with a built-in a step counter which monitors the amount of activity taken throughout the day. Parents and children can set daily step targets, turning everyday exercise into a fun game. Some models even gamify the process, offering virtual rewards or points for reaching goals, which can be extremely inspiring for a a younger audience. This engaging method can help foster a healthy relationship with physical exercise from a very young stage in life.
In addition to just counting steps, these versatile devices can serve as helpful personal reminders for establishing healthy routines. Parents can set personalized alarms for a range of tasks, such as "time to drink water," "finish your homework," or "get ready for bed." These gentle nudges on the child's device can prove more successful compared to repeated parental requests, fostering a degree of time management and personal responsibility. The combination of fitness monitoring and scheduled reminders makes a kids' smart watch a holistic instrument for encouraging a child's total well-being. It subtly guides youngsters towards a healthier lifestyle, blending technology effortlessly into their their everyday lives in a constructive and beneficial manner.
A Responsible, Distraction-Free Introduction to Technology
Introducing a child their first personal gadget is a significant milestone for every parent. While modern phones offer immense functionality, they also present present a universe of potential problems, from time-consuming games and unfiltered internet access to the dynamics of social media. A specialized wearable for young people acts as a perfect compromise, offering the essential benefits of connectivity without most of the drawbacks. These devices are intentionally created with a limited and curated feature set. They do not have unrestricted internet access and the ability to download random apps, which means parents do not need to be concerned about their youngster stumbling upon inappropriate material or spending endless time on mindless entertainment.
This distraction-free design is especially beneficial at critical times like class time and homework periods. Most these watches are equipped with a "School Mode" or "Focus Mode" feature that can be enabled by the parent or on a pre-set timetable. Once this mode is turned on, it essentially disables all distracting functions such as messaging and calls, transforming the watch into a simple watch that can still display the time and be accessed in case of emergency emergencies. This guarantees that the device does not be a disruption in the environment or interfere with a child's capacity to concentrate. By providing a controlled and focused entry point into the world of mobile technology, these smart watches assist children to develop technological responsibility in a structured structured and age-appropriate fashion.
